Transaction 3690f3ecdcf7135462180cceffdce7922cb95af4abf7e577d22be7d0d4d017f6
1 Input
1 Output
-
3690f3ecdcf7135462180cceffdce7922cb95af4abf7e577d22be7d0d4d017f6:0
- value
- 5386860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3763c5b5f3d12bfceb8195d4b24ae61615672 OP_EQUAL
- address
- 3BMEXiGsnP4E8TQQDa21BMmh49S5Yeorph